Transaction 70fa86955edbc69897600d30c4e1e8caedc140ebf1c72b34a0aa63968ed85fa5

1 Input
2 Outputs
  • 70fa86955edbc69897600d30c4e1e8caedc140ebf1c72b34a0aa63968ed85fa5:0
  • value  3598475
    address  19UxT1aWBY9WyQpGvZ1MChrHPmZXu1ouaR
  • 70fa86955edbc69897600d30c4e1e8caedc140ebf1c72b34a0aa63968ed85fa5:1
  • value  77423276
    address  3CsjUk5c4bgnCfEr1K74AL4RjRU24Uvmum